**StormFan alert fan-out stalled.** Check the Gale queue depth first; if above 10k, the Nimbus dispatcher is likely wedged. Restart dispatcher pods one at a time — never all at once, or subscribers in the Kestrel region will double-receive. Verify delivery by posting a synthetic alert to the staging fan-out endpoint. That call requires elevated dispatch credentials, not the standard service account. Use the on-call bearer token below when issuing the synthetic alert request.

session JWT of yawep-yawep = eyJhbGciOiJIUzI1NiIsInR5cCI6IkpXVCJ9.eyJzdWIiOiI3pWF3_In0.aXYsHiog

Approvals: Tide-table widget

Scope: the Shoreline tide-table widget in the Harborly app. Data source is the Moonmark feed; refresh every 6 hours. Support may not push manual tide corrections — ever. Display changes (units, station labels, timezone handling) need written approval before release. Outage banners for the widget also require sign-off. No exceptions for the Pellan Bay stations, which have regulatory display rules. Submit requests through the standard approvals queue. All approvals for this widget go through the owner listed below.

named custodian: Belius Casath Ulaix Sorius

Hi, and welcome to on-call! Quick heads-up about Sweepwright, our data-retention sweeper. It runs nightly at 02:00 and occasionally pages if a purge batch exceeds its time budget — usually harmless, just re-queue it. Don't ever pause it for more than 24 hours without telling the Compliance folks. The full playbook, including the re-queue steps, is here.

operations page: https://jenkins.zemvarcloud.local/job/merge_requests/repo/build/73930b4b30f0a8ed

Ticket: config drift on Pindrop thumbnail queue. Staging and prod-east disagree on worker concurrency and retry backoff; prod-east was hand-edited during the March incident and never reconciled. Result: thumbnails lag ~9 min in east only. Proposal: make staging the source of truth, re-apply via the deploy pipeline, and lock manual edits. For reference, the intended canonical values are listed below.

config for kafof-bawef:
holath:
  log_level: debug
  metrics_host: metrics.holath.qorvelsys.internal
  pin: 2191
  pool_size: 32